Office Forum
www.Office-Loesung.de
Access :: Excel :: Outlook :: PowerPoint :: Word :: Office :: Wieder Online ---> provisorisches Office Forum <-
Textfeld mit Aktualisierung durch Kombifeld
zurück: Suche mit Kombofeld weiter: Formular nur für Eingabe nutzen und Indexsuche Unbeantwortete Beiträge anzeigen
Neues Thema eröffnen   Neue Antwort erstellen     Status: Bitte Status wählen ! Facebook-Likes Diese Seite Freunden empfehlen
Zu Browser-Favoriten hinzufügen
Autor Nachricht
Bastian_2
Einsteiger


Verfasst am:
22. Aug 2005, 08:55
Rufname:

Textfeld mit Aktualisierung durch Kombifeld - Textfeld mit Aktualisierung durch Kombifeld

Nach oben
       

Hallo,

habe folgendes Problem. In einem gebundenen Formular habe ich zwei Kombifelder und ein Textfeld. Je nach dem was ich in den Kombifeldern ausgewählt habe soll in meinem Textfeld der zugehörige Eintrag aus einer anderen Tabelle eingetragen werden.

<<Also aus der Kombination der Kombifelder kann ich in einer anderen Tabelle einen Datensatz genau klassifizieren>>

Habe das ganze über einen kleinen VBA-Code gelöst der soweit auch ganz gut funktioniert.
Code:
    Me![Typ_Sicherung] = _
        DLookup("[Typ_Sicherung]", "[T_Zu_Abgaenge]", _
                "[Bez_Verteiler]='" & Me![Von_Bez_Verteiler] & "' " & _
            "AND [Bez_Zu_Abgang] ='" & Me![Von_Bez_Zu_Abgang] & "'")
Zur Zeit habe ich diesen als Ereignis "nach Aktualisierung" vom zweiten Kombifeld eingetragen.

Nun habe ich folgendes Problem: wenn ich einen anderen vorhandenen Datensatz Aufrufe wird das Textfeld nicht aktualisiert also es steht immernoch der vorhergehende Wert drin. Das selbe Problem tritt auf wenn ich einen neuen Datensatz anlegen möchte. Auch dort bleibt bis zur Änderung des zweiten Kombifeldes der alte Wert stehen.

Hat jemand eine Idee wie ich das Problem lösen kann??

Mfg Bastian_2
Florus
Access-Nichtversteher


Verfasst am:
22. Aug 2005, 10:39
Rufname:
Wohnort: NÖ / Österreich


Hi - Hi

Nach oben
       

Guten Morgen!

Is nur mal eine Idee,

aber versuch einfach mal also Code beim Anzeigen:
Code:
    Me!deintextfeld = ""
So wird nach jedem Datensatzsprung das Textfeld geleert.

Liebe Grüße

Florus

_________________
Bitte um F E E D B A C K!

THX
-------------------------------------------------
Bastian_2
Einsteiger


Verfasst am:
22. Aug 2005, 11:04
Rufname:

AW: Textfeld mit Aktualisierung durch Kombifeld - AW: Textfeld mit Aktualisierung durch Kombifeld

Nach oben
       

Hallo Florus,

Danke erstmal für den Tipp. Das ist eine Möglichkeit wie ich den alten Wert herausbekomme. Aber wie bekomme ich den neuen Wert wieder herein. Also wenn ich zum nächsten Datensatz gesprungen bin soll das Textfeld ja wieder aus einer Abfrage gefüllt werden.

Mfg bastian
Florus
Access-Nichtversteher


Verfasst am:
22. Aug 2005, 11:20
Rufname:
Wohnort: NÖ / Österreich

Hi - Hi

Nach oben
       

Dann versuchs einfach mal so:

Ebenfalls als Code beim Anzeigen:
Code:
    Dim ssql As String

    strSQL = "SELECT * FROM tbl_mobil " & _
             "WHERE namen Like '" & Me!kombo1 & "' " & _
             "AND namen Like '" & Me!kombo2 & "'"
    Set rs = DBEngine(0)(0).OpenRecordset(strSQL)
    Me!deintextfeld = rs!deintabellenfeld
    rs.Close
    Set rs = Nothing

Um genaueres sagen zu können, wäre ein paar mehr Informationen nötig,
z.B wie setzt sich die Suchvariable zusammen, was steht wo usw.

Liebe Grüße

Florus

_________________
Bitte um F E E D B A C K!

THX
-------------------------------------------------
Bastian_2
Einsteiger


Verfasst am:
22. Aug 2005, 12:19
Rufname:

AW: Textfeld mit Aktualisierung durch Kombifeld - AW: Textfeld mit Aktualisierung durch Kombifeld

Nach oben
       

Hallo Florus,

danke für den Tipp. Hab zwar deinen Quellcode nicht ganz verstanden. Dieser hat mich allerdings auf die richtige Idee gebracht. ich hatte ja schon wie gesagt einen Code der das Feld ausfüllt. allerdings hat er das nur gemacht wenn ich in dem Kombifeld was neues ausgewählt habe.

Nun habe ich diesen Code auch "beim Anzeigen" eingegeben und es funktioniert wunderbar.
Code:
Private Sub Von_Bez_Zu_Abgang_AfterUpdate()
    Me![Typ_Sicherung] = _
        DLookup("[Typ_Sicherung]", "[T_Zu_Abgaenge]", _
                "[Bez_Verteiler]='" & Me![Von_Bez_Verteiler] & "' " & _
            "AND [Bez_Zu_Abgang] ='" & Me![Von_Bez_Zu_Abgang] & "'")
    Me![Max_Strom] = _
        DLookup("[Strom_Sicherung]", "[T_Zu_Abgaenge]", _
                "[Bez_Verteiler]='" & Me![Von_Bez_Verteiler] & "' " & _
                "AND [Bez_Zu_Abgang] ='" & Me![Von_Bez_Zu_Abgang] & "'")
End Sub

Also Dankeschön nochmal

Liebe Grüße

Bastian
Florus
Access-Nichtversteher


Verfasst am:
22. Aug 2005, 12:31
Rufname:
Wohnort: NÖ / Österreich


Super - Super

Nach oben
       

Es freut mich immer wieder,
wenn ich helfen kann.

Einen schönen Tag noch!

Liebe Grüße

Florus

_________________
Bitte um F E E D B A C K!

THX
-------------------------------------------------
Neues Thema eröffnen   Neue Antwort erstellen Alle Zeiten sind
GMT + 1 Stunde

Diese Seite Freunden empfehlen

Seite 1 von 1
Gehe zu:  
Du kannst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um nicht posten
Du kannst Dateien in diesem Forum herunterladen

Verwandte Themen
Forum / Themen   Antworten   Autor   Aufrufe   Letzter Beitrag 
Keine neuen Beiträge Access Tabellen & Abfragen: Automatische Bestandserfassung und Umbuchung/ Aktualisierung 10 rosert 1924 08. Nov 2006, 17:14
rosert Automatische Bestandserfassung und Umbuchung/ Aktualisierung
Keine neuen Beiträge Access Tabellen & Abfragen: textfeld nur positive zahlen 1 Herbert999 4054 19. Sep 2006, 10:28
jens05 textfeld nur positive zahlen
Keine neuen Beiträge Access Tabellen & Abfragen: Änderungen in zwei Tabellen / Aktualisierung 7 Gaeltacht 1107 21. Aug 2006, 19:55
jens05 Änderungen in zwei Tabellen / Aktualisierung
Keine neuen Beiträge Access Tabellen & Abfragen: aktualisierung WANN? 2 Highlander 487 02. Aug 2006, 17:01
Willi Wipp aktualisierung WANN?
Dieses Thema ist gesperrt, du kannst keine Beiträge editieren oder beantworten. Access Tabellen & Abfragen: probleme mit abfrage (kombifeld) 1 thunder1000 508 07. Jan 2006, 21:32
jens05 probleme mit abfrage (kombifeld)
Keine neuen Beiträge Access Tabellen & Abfragen: Zeilenumbruch bei Textfeld 3 F1 1617 01. Jan 2006, 15:19
F1 Zeilenumbruch bei Textfeld
Keine neuen Beiträge Access Tabellen & Abfragen: Aktualisierung von Kombinationsfeldern 9 kiri 785 28. Nov 2005, 09:53
YpY Aktualisierung von Kombinationsfeldern
Keine neuen Beiträge Access Tabellen & Abfragen: Wert aus Textfeld für Abfrage auslesen 2 Sonic 6622 23. Jun 2005, 08:08
Sonic Wert aus Textfeld für Abfrage auslesen
Keine neuen Beiträge Access Tabellen & Abfragen: Kombifeld mit Unterform verknüpfen ??? 4 Sonic 693 08. Jun 2005, 09:43
Sonic Kombifeld mit Unterform verknüpfen ???
Keine neuen Beiträge Access Tabellen & Abfragen: Textfeld Abfrage 2 Sandro 712 02. Feb 2005, 11:56
Sandro Textfeld Abfrage
Keine neuen Beiträge Access Tabellen & Abfragen: Kombifeld als Kriterium in Abfrage 2 robbe 583 21. Jan 2005, 11:16
lupos Kombifeld als Kriterium in Abfrage
Keine neuen Beiträge Access Tabellen & Abfragen: Textlänge in einem Textfeld 4 brauchehilfe@office 2425 30. Okt 2004, 00:05
brauchehilfe@office Textlänge in einem Textfeld
 

----> Diese Seite Freunden empfehlen <------ Impressum - Besuchen Sie auch: PHP JavaScript